首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何等待脚本完成并在IE弹出窗口中单击“确定”

在IE浏览器中,等待脚本完成并在弹出窗口中单击“确定”按钮,可以通过以下步骤实现:

  1. 使用Selenium WebDriver库进行自动化测试。Selenium WebDriver是一个用于浏览器自动化的工具,可以模拟用户在浏览器中的操作。
  2. 在脚本中,使用WebDriver打开IE浏览器,并导航到需要执行操作的网页。
  3. 在执行需要等待的操作之前,使用WebDriver的WebDriverWait类设置一个等待条件。例如,可以等待一个特定的元素在页面中出现,或者等待一个特定的JavaScript脚本执行完成。
  4. 在等待条件满足后,执行需要点击“确定”按钮的操作。可以使用WebDriver的switch_to.alert方法切换到弹出窗口,并使用accept方法点击“确定”按钮。

以下是一个示例代码:

代码语言:python
代码运行次数:0
复制
from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.support.ui import WebDriverWait
from selenium.webdriver.support import expected_conditions as EC

# 创建IE浏览器实例
driver = webdriver.Ie()

# 导航到需要执行操作的网页
driver.get("https://example.com")

# 设置等待条件,等待弹出窗口出现
wait = WebDriverWait(driver, 10)
alert = wait.until(EC.alert_is_present())

# 切换到弹出窗口并点击“确定”按钮
alert.accept()

# 关闭浏览器
driver.quit()

在上述示例中,使用了Python编程语言和Selenium WebDriver库来实现等待脚本完成并在IE弹出窗口中单击“确定”按钮的操作。请注意,这只是一个示例,实际应用中可能需要根据具体情况进行调整。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,无法提供相关链接。但腾讯云提供了一系列云计算服务,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券